返回首页

如何用labview与西门子PLC串口通迅?

63 2024-07-15 14:31 admin   手机版

一、如何用labview与西门子PLC串口通迅?

补充一下上面两位朋友的看法。

在西门子的plc侧也需要针对自由口进行一些程序的编制。如果是200系列plc,一般都自带一个自由口;如果是300系列的话,需要增加一个自由口通讯模块

二、PLC触摸屏不显示?

1.

触摸屏原因:

如果触摸屏提示错误信息,请根据错误信息参考说明书排除故障;

NS系列,屏幕右下角显示“connecting”,但不显示屏幕。 进入系统菜单检查NS的COM口设置是否与plc的协议和波特率一致,将不用的串口设置为NONE;

2.

PLC原因:

电缆损坏或接线不正确,请检查接线;

三、PLC串口通讯原理?

第三方设备大部分支持,西门子S7PLC可以通过选择自由口通信模式控制串口通信。最简单的情况只用发送指令 (XMT)向打印机或者变频器等第三方设备发送信息。

不管任何情况,都必须通过 S7 PLC编写程序实现。

当选择了自由口模式,用户可以通过发送指令(XMT)、接收指(RCV)、发送中断、接收中断来控制通信口的操作。

2、PPI 通信 PPI 协议是S7-200CPU 最基本的通信方式,通过原来自身的端口 (PORT0 或PORT1)就可以实现通信,是 S7-200 CPU 默认的通信方式。

PPI是一种主-从协议通信,主-从站在一个令牌环网中。在CPU内用户网络读写指令即可,也就是说网络读写指令是运行在PPI协议上的。

因此 PPI 只在主站侧编写程序就可以了,从站的网络读写指令没有什么意义。 3、MPI 通信 MPI通信是一种比简单的通信方式,MPI网络通信的速率是19.2Kbit/s~12Mbit/s,MPI网络最多支持连接32个节点,最大通信距离为50M。通信距离远,还可以通过中继器扩展通信距离,但中继器也占用节点。

MPI网络节点通常可以挂S7-200、人机介面、编程设备等。

四、plc串口坏了怎么办?

如果PLC的串口坏了,可以考虑以下步骤:

检查连接: 确保串口连接线、插头和接口没有问题,有时候问题可能仅仅是松动或接触不良。

更换线缆: 如果线缆损坏,尝试更换新的线缆以解决问题。

配置: 检查PLC的串口配置和参数,确保它们正确设置。

维修或更换: 如果以上步骤无法解决问题,可能需要联系专业技术人员或PLC制造商进行维修或更换串口模块。

备份数据: 在维修之前,务必备份PLC中的重要数据,以防数据丢失。

五、PLC的COM1?

计算机的com是九针的串口 plc的com1、com2是某一组输出或者输入的公共端 看看plc的硬件说明

六、怎么才能把串口的数据读到PLC上呢?s7-200,rs485?

西门子PLC针对外部设备,使用串口通信时,协议为MODBUS,但通常为2种方式,1是PLC为主站,读取外部设备信号,比如变频器,温控器等,从网上下载西门子200PLC指令库,调用里面的集成指令MASTER即可,不会写的找到那些指令按F1,帮助里都有范例。然后对照设备厂家的数据接口表,从接收到的数据里剥离自己想要的数据,逻辑处理后再写进去。

第2种是PLC是从站,响应外部主站信号,比如楼宇自控系统要读取你PLC的数据,就走MODBUS协议,在指令库里找到SLAVER指令,调用。

至于什么接口并不是重点,接口可以转化,

七、c语言如何与plc串口通信?

要在C语言中与PLC进行串口通信,你需要使用串口通信库或API来实现。通常,你需要打开串口设备、设置串口参数(如波特率、数据位、停止位等)、发送数据到PLC,然后接收PLC的响应数据。具体实现方法会因使用的操作系统和串口设备而异。

常用的串口通信库包括Windows下的WinAPI、Linux下的termios库等。在C语言中调用这些库函数,可以实现与PLC的串口通信。与PLC的通信协议和数据格式也需要与PLC进行适配,确保通信正确和稳定。

八、plc与电脑串口通信怎样设置?

要将PLC与电脑通过串口通信,您需要完成以下步骤:

  1. 确定PLC的串口号和波特率。这些信息通常可以在PLC的手册或设置菜单中找到。

  2. 在电脑上安装串口驱动程序。这通常需要从PLC制造商的网站上下载并安装适当的驱动程序。

  3. 打开串口通信软件。您可以使用任何可用的串口通信软件,例如TeraTerm、SecureCRT等。

  4. 在串口通信软件中选择正确的串口号和波特率。这些设置应该与PLC的设置相匹配。

  5. 配置其他必要的参数,例如数据位、停止位和校验位。这些参数也应该根据PLC的设置进行配置。

  6. 通过串口通信软件向PLC发送命令和数据。您可以使用PLC编程软件或其他工具来编写和发送指令和数据。

  7. 从PLC接收命令和数据。一旦PLC返回响应,您就可以在串口通信软件中查看结果。

请注意,具体步骤可能因PLC型号和软件而异。因此,最好参考您的PLC手册或联系PLC制造商以获取更详细的指导。

顶一下
(0)
0%
踩一下
(0)
0%
用户反馈
问题反馈
用户名: 验证码:点击我更换图片